Structure

The edges of the umbrellas are connected and reacting on eachother. Each umbrella has sensors which are reacting on the sun/rain/wind/night/etc... Besides that they can be programmed for special days, for example events. The only disadvantage of the umbrella is that the space underneath the created roofs is 'flat', it has no accomodations.

Situation1road.jpg

Situation 1: This image shows how the road divides the site into two spaces. Green used by BK-City, red used by Science Centre and the student residential.

Situation2road.jpg

Situation 2: When the road changes its direction the spaces could be divided in different ways. The umbrellas are creating roofs and seperations between spaces.

Situation3road.jpg

Situation 3: When the road is at its 'maximum' the site can be used for events or the Mondays when the Science Centre is closed.
